"Special Problems" is a volume from the "Life Library of Photography" series published by Time-Life Books in 1972. This series comprehensively explores various facets of photography, including equipment technology, shooting techniques, film development, printing, historical context, and the artistic aspects of photography.
The "Special Problems" book delves into advanced photographic techniques and addresses unique challenges that photographers may encounter. It features contributions from esteemed photographers, such as Bill Binzen, who is renowned for his innovative "sandwiching" techniquea method of combining multiple images to create unique visual effects.
